Understanding the Core Mechanics of the Aviator Game
At its heart, the aviator game is remarkably simple. A player places a bet, and a plane begins to ascend. As the plane takes altitude, a multiplier increases. The longer the plane flies, the higher the multiplier – and the larger the potential payout. However, this increased reward comes with increased risk. The plane can “crash” at any moment, meaning the multiplier resets, and any bets that haven’t been cashed out are lost. This core dynamic of risk versus reward is what defines the game’s captivating nature.
Successful gameplay hinges on carefully timing your cash-out. Players can choose to cash out at any point, securing a profit based on the current multiplier. Many skilled players use strategies like setting automatic cash-out points, or employing techniques to analyze past flight patterns, though it’s important to remember that each flight is largely independent. It’s a game of nerves, calculation, and a touch of luck.

Technological Aspects and Fairness Considerations
The fairness and integrity of the aviator game rely heavily on the underlying technology. Reputable platforms employ provably fair systems, which use cryptographic techniques to ensure that the outcome of each flight is random and unbiased. These systems allow players to independently verify the fairness of the game, providing transparency and reassurance. The use of a random number generator (RNG) is essential to eliminate any possibility of manipulation.
The implementation of secure and reliable server infrastructure is also vital. This involves protecting against potential cyberattacks and ensuring the smooth operation of the game. Reputable operators invest heavily in security measures to safeguard players’ funds and personal information. Before engaging with any platform, research its licensing credentials.
